26:39Good morning, Commissioners, attendees, and everyone watching the stream.
26:42This is the OIG quarterly report for the first quarter, and it was issued on April 15, 2026.
26:49Due to the OIG ordinance restrictions, I can only discuss the contents within the OIG quarterly report, other information as part of our investigative files and confidential.
27:09We received a total of 190 complaints compared to the 208 complaints received during the previous quarter.
30:00Four additional programs did not appear to provide meaningful service to the community.
30:03The OIG found that program oversight was weak with inadequate monitoring of grantee performance.
30:10The JC did not require repayment of funds from non-compliant grantees.
30:16Additionally, the OIG investigated the complaint against the building and zoning department.
30:23Allegations were a private resident was operating as an illegal boarding house.
30:29The OIG gathered evidence that supports the allegation that the residence was being used as an unauthorized board in house.
30:37Investigators identified gaps in investigative procedures and documentation.
30:42The review recommended strengthening standard operating procedures for investigators at building and zoning.
30:48The OIG recommended building zoning to reopen the case.
